25. Stability analysis of a large span timber dome
University essay from Lunds universitet/Avdelningen för KonstruktionsteknikAbstract : The aim of this thesis is to study the feasibility of building a timber dome with a span of 300 metres, concerning elastic stability. The load-bearing members were modelled with the properties of glued laminated timber GL30c with the dimensions 0.8×1.6 m2. READ MORE
